An Android app and Chrome extension for searching the Android SDK documentation.
Clone or download
JakeWharton Add quiet mode to validator
When running on CI, tee prints every status update into the resulting file which is extremely noisy.
Latest commit ade9131 Oct 16, 2018
Permalink
Failed to load latest commit information.
.circleci Add quiet mode to validator Oct 16, 2018
.idea/runConfigurations Add URL intercepting Jul 3, 2018
api Port to new Kotlin multiplatform plugin Oct 9, 2018
art Add raster debug icons for Android Jul 15, 2018
bugsnag-tree Switch to multiplatform Timber snapshot. Jun 1, 2018
chrome-platform Move Chrome instance to separate module Jul 15, 2018
debug-updater Fix formatting Sep 22, 2018
frontend Enable R8's full mode Oct 16, 2018
gradle Port to new Kotlin multiplatform plugin Oct 9, 2018
options Switch to non-deprecated channel factory Oct 16, 2018
presentation Port to new Kotlin multiplatform plugin Oct 9, 2018
references Add quiet mode to validator Oct 16, 2018
roboto Migrate to AndroidX Sep 16, 2018
search Switch to non-deprecated channel factory Oct 16, 2018
sqldelight-coroutines-extensions Use channel close callback to remove query listener Oct 2, 2018
store SQL Delight 1.0 rc2 Oct 16, 2018
sync Port to new Kotlin multiplatform plugin Oct 9, 2018
.editorconfig ktlint Mar 29, 2018
.gitignore Strip non-path components from source URL lookups Jul 17, 2018
CHANGELOG.md Prepare version 1.3.4 Jul 16, 2018
LICENSE.txt Initial scaffold. Jul 19, 2017
README.md List building prereqs in the README Jul 17, 2018
build.gradle Force all Kotlin stdlib artifacts to the same version Oct 16, 2018
gradle.properties Enable R8's full mode Oct 16, 2018
gradlew Modernize build and versions. Dec 14, 2017
gradlew.bat Modernize build and versions. Dec 14, 2017
init.gradle Name and place trace files like profile files Aug 2, 2018
lint.xml Enable SyntheticAccessor check. Apr 18, 2018
settings.gradle Port to new Kotlin multiplatform plugin Oct 9, 2018

README.md

SDK Search

An Android app and Chrome Extension for searching the Android SDK documentation.

Google Play Chrome Web Store
Download! Install!

Building

Prerequisites:

  • JDK 8 (kapt doesn't like 9 or 10, TODO find/file a bug for this)
  • Node 8 or newer
  • Android SDK unzipped and ANDROID_HOME environment variable set to its path.

License

Copyright 2016 Jake Wharton

Licensed under the Apache License, Version 2.0 (the "License");
you may not use this file except in compliance with the License.
You may obtain a copy of the License at

   http://www.apache.org/licenses/LICENSE-2.0

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.